    I own this exact boat (but with cockpit teak deck) and its nice but it has a laundry list of short comings. The single piece companionway door is obnoxiously heavy, the flush deck handle above and below the saloon are nearly useless for quick grabbing, the vanity and desk in the master cabin is a total waste of good storage space, the lack of a generator is pathetic, both Lazaretts are not sealed and so they leak into the cabins below if you wash them out ( I double checked this with Jeanneau), the galley counter space is minimal (especially compared to the 410 or 440), the lighting is too bright, and the flex lamps are nearly useless with no red filter at the map table. Aside form this it's a good boat, best sold to charter fleets. I will be upgrading to something much better thought out in a few years.
